Output a8af73211351dd6e618b5954dfee0d230bf58406fc33b9534ea03827e95d55a6:1

value
42852546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b22c837bf36a482c41e28e132d686e003369e6 OP_EQUAL
address
3MzXNsKawKrm4nf2iYGsbCCdstqijMhayA
transaction
a8af73211351dd6e618b5954dfee0d230bf58406fc33b9534ea03827e95d55a6
confirmations
72138
spent
true